3VTE

Crystal structure of tetrahydrocannabinolic acid synthase from Cannabis sativa

Experimental procedure
Experimental methodSINGLE WAVELENGTH
Source typeSYNCHROTRON
Source detailsPHOTON FACTORY BEAMLINE AR-NW12A
Synchrotron sitePhoton Factory
BeamlineAR-NW12A
Temperature [K]100
Detector technologyCCD
Collection date2006-06-11
DetectorADSC QUANTUM 210
Wavelength(s)1.0000
Spacegroup nameP 4 3 2
Unit cell lengths177.946, 177.946, 177.946
Unit cell angles90.00, 90.00, 90.00
Refinement procedure
Resolution44.490 - 2.750
R-factor0.20111
Rwork0.198
R-free0.25039
Structure solution methodMOLECULAR REPLACEMENT
Starting model (for MR)2axr
RMSD bond length0.018
RMSD bond angle1.919
Data reduction softwareHKL-2000
Data scaling softwareHKL-2000
Phasing softwarePHASER
Refinement softwareREFMAC (5.5.0109)
Data quality characteristics
 OverallOuter shell
Low resolution limit [Å]44.5002.850
High resolution limit [Å]2.7502.750
Number of reflections25537
<I/σ(I)>14.6
Completeness [%]99.498.8
Redundancy15.65.6
Crystallization Conditions
crystal IDmethodpHtemperaturedetails
1VAPOR DIFFUSION, HANGING DROP7.52930.09M HEPES, 1.26M SODIUM CITRATE, pH 7.5, VAPOR DIFFUSION, HANGING DROP, temperature 293K
